FCC Class A Notice

This device complies with part 15
of
the FCC Rules. Operation
is
subject
to
the following
two
conditions:
1.
This
device may not cause harmful interference, and
2.
This
device must accept
any
interference
received,
including interference that
may
cause undesired operation.
®
This
equipment
has
been
tested
and
found
to comply with
the
limits
for a
Class
A digital
device,
pursuant to
Part
15 of
the
FCC
Rules.
These
limits
are
designed
to provide
reasonable
protection
against
harmful
interference
when
the
equipment
is
operated
in
a
commercial
environment.
This
equipment
generates,
uses,
and
can
radiate
radio frequency
energy
and
, if not
installed
and
used
in
accordance with
the
ins
truction
manual,
may
cause
harmful
interference to
radio
communications. Operation of this equipment
in
a
residential
area
is
likely
to
cause
harmful
interference
in
which ca
se
the user
will
be
required
to correct
the
interference
at
his
own
expense.

FCC

Class B Notice

This device complies with
part
15
of
the
FCC
Rules. Operation is subject to the following
two
conditions:
1. This device may not cause
harmful
interference, and
2.
This
device must accept
any
interference received, including interference that may cause undesired operation.
®
This
equipment
has
been
t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 15
of
the
FCC
Rules.
These
limits
are
designed to provide reasonable protection against
harmful
interference
in
a
residential
installation.
This
equipment generates,
uses
and
can
radiate radio frequency
energy
and, if not installed and used
in
accordance with the instructions,
may
cause harmful interference to radio communications.
However,
there is
no
guarantee that interference
will
not occur in a
partic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can
be
determined
by
turning the equipment off and
on,
the user is encouraged to try
to
correct the interference by one or
more
of the following measures:
-
Reorient
or relocate the
receiving
antenna.
-
Increase
the separation between the equipment and
receiver.
-Connect the equipment into
an
outlet
on
a circuit different
from
that
to
which
the
receiver is connected.
-Consult the dealer or
an
experienced radio/TV technician for
help
.
